Drain Pipework (ONLY ERSE series)
The drain pipe should be installed to drain condensing water in Cooling mode.
To prevent dirty water from draining directly onto the floor next to hydrobox, please
connect appropriate discharge pipework from the hydrobox.
• Securely install the drain pipe to prevent leakage from the connection.
• Securely insulate the drain pipe to prevent water dripping from the locally supplied
drain pipe.
• Install the drain pipe at a down slope of 1/100 or more.
• Do not place the drain pipe in drain channel where sulfuric gas exists.
• After installation, check that the drain pipe drains water properly from the outlet of
the pipe to suitable discharge location.
<Installation>
1. Apply polyvinyl chloride type adhesive over the shaded surfaces inside of the
drain pipe and on the exterior of the drain socket as shown.
2. Insert the drain socket deeply into the drain pipe <Figure 4.3.2>.
Note: Securely support the locally supplied drain pipe using pipe support to
avoid the drain pipe falling from the drain socket.
<Checking Drainage>
• Check that the drain pipe drains water properly from the outlet of the pipe.
• Check for any leakage from the connections.
Note: Always check drainage at installation regardless of season.
• Remove the front panel and gradually pour 1 liter of water into the drain pan
<Figure 4.3.3>.
Note: Pour water slowly into the drain pan so that water does not overflow
from the drain pan.

Filling the System (Primary Circuit)

1. Check all connections including factory fitted ones are tight.
2. Check the pump valve and the strainer valve are opened completely.
3. Insulate pipework between hydrobox and outdoor unit.
4. Thoroughly clean and flush, system of all debris. (see section 4.2 for instruction.)
5. Fill hydrobox with potable water. Fill primary heating circuit with water and
suitable anti-freeze and inhibitor as necessary. Always use a filling loop with
double check valve when filling the primary circuit to avoid back flow
contamination of water supply.
• Anti-freeze should always be used for packaged model systems (see
section 4.2 for instruction). It is the responsibility of the installer to decide
if anti-freeze solution should be used in split model systems depending
on each site's conditions. Corrosion inhibitor should be used in both split
model and packaged model systems.
Figure 4.3.4 shows freezing temperature against anti-freeze concentration.
This figure is an example for FERNOX ALPHI-11. For other anti-freeze,
please refer to relevant manual.
• When connecting metal pipes of different materials insulate the joints to
prevent a corrosive reaction taking place which will damage the pipework.
6. Check for leakages. If leakage is found, retighten the screws onto the
connections.
7. Pressurise system to 1 bar.
8. Release all trapped air using air vents during and following heating period.
9. Top up with water as necessary. (If pressure is below 1 bar)
